Three Problems With Portfolio-Wide Energy Projects

Every multi-site operator we work with has tried to run their energy optimization projects without a written roadmap at some point. It almost always breaks down in one of three ways, and the cost is always larger than the cost of the engagement that would have prevented it.

Random Sequencing

Sites get done based on whichever facility manager is loudest, which lease is expiring soon, or which region the install crew happens to be in. The result: high-ROI sites get pushed to year 3, low-ROI sites get done first, and the cumulative savings curve is materially lower than it should be. We’ve seen this pattern cost $2M+ in unrealized savings on portfolios of 100+ sites.

Missed Incentives

Utility rebate programs change quarterly. Tier bonuses open and close. Incentive program rules shift. When sites aren’t sequenced against these calendars, programs that should have funded the project quietly disappear. The retrofit still gets done but you pay full price instead of the incentive-adjusted price.

Regulatory Whiplash

Commercial fluorescent lighting bans, local energy benchmarking ordinances, state-level efficiency mandates are in constant flux. When sites in different jurisdictions aren’t tracked against the right regulatory calendars, you could end up retrofitting a site twice; once to decrease your energy spend and again to bring it into regulatory compliance. The wasted spend can run into seven figures across a national portfolio.

Portfolio Program FAQs

What's the minimum portfolio size for a PEC engagement?

We typically work with portfolios of 25 or more sites, though we’ve delivered roadmaps for portfolios as small as 10 (when site complexity warrants) and as large as 650+. The engagement scales, what doesn’t scale is the value of having one sequencing strategy across the whole footprint.

Is the Portfolio Roadmap free?

The initial Portfolio Briefing — a 60-minute strategic call with your leadership team — is free with no commitment. The full Portfolio Roadmap engagement (4–8 weeks of work) is a paid engagement priced based on portfolio size. The cost is typically a fraction of the value the roadmap unlocks. For most customers, PEC credits the roadmap fee against the first executed project.

What if my sites span multiple states and multiple utilities?

That’s exactly the situation the roadmap is built for. PEC has active incentive program relationships across most major North American utilities, and the roadmap explicitly maps your portfolio against each utility’s program calendar, tier structure, and funding state.

Do we have to use PEC for the actual installs after the roadmap is delivered?

No. The roadmap is yours. You can use it to bid the work to other contractors, manage the program in-house, or engage PEC for execution. Most customers choose PEC for execution because the same team that built the roadmap runs the installs — but it’s an entirely separate decision.

How does PEC account for regulatory changes throughout the process?

Roadmaps include a regulatory risk register at delivery. For customers who continue with PEC for execution, the roadmap is updated quarterly to reflect utility program changes, federal policy updates, and new state mandates. Customers without an execution agreement can purchase annual roadmap updates.

Can PEC include EV charging and energy monitoring, not just lighting?

Yes. The Portfolio Roadmap covers your full energy infrastructure — LED retrofits, EV charging deployment, and energy monitoring rollouts — sequenced together. This is especially valuable when multiple infrastructure changes share a single utility incentive program or regulatory deadline.

How does the portfolio process interact with our internal capex planning cycle?

PEC builds the capex pacing schedule to align with your fiscal year and your finance team’s planning horizon. We can model accelerated, paced, and conservative deployment scenarios so your CFO sees the trade-offs explicitly.

What kind of executive visibility does PEC provide?

PEC produces board-ready summary slides, ESG-reporting language, and CFO capital-planning views as standard outputs. It’s designed to be the source document for executive and board updates throughout the program.

How long does the actual portfolio rollout take after the roadmap is approved?

Most multi-site programs run 18–60 months from kickoff to completion, depending on portfolio size and capex pacing. The roadmap establishes the timeline; execution typically beats it on the high-ROI front-loaded sites.

What if our portfolio is growing — through acquisition or new construction?

The roadmap is a living document for ongoing PEC customers. New sites (acquired or built) are integrated into the framework as they join the portfolio. Lithia Motors is the model case: nearly 300 dealerships absorbed into one rolling program over a decade.
